基于RS技术的20年来厦门城市热岛格局变化研究

摘    要:应用IB算法反演厦门市地表温度,整合1996—2013年Landsat-5和Landsat-8卫星影像数据,定量分析厦门市城市热岛的时空变化。结果表明,近20年来厦门市建成区空间分布发生了巨大的变化,热岛的时空演变和建成区的密集度分布基本吻合。

Research on the Change of Urban Heat Island Patterns in Xiamen City in the Past 20 Years Based on RS Technology

Abstract:Using the IB algorithm to invert the surface temperature of Xiamen City, the Landsat 5 and Landsat 8 satellite image data from 1996 to 2013 were analyzed, and the spatial and temporal changes of urban heat island in Xiamen were quantitatively analyzed. The results show that the spatial distribution of the built area in Xiamen City has changed greatly over the past 20 years, and the spa-tial and temporal evolution of the heat island and the density distribution of the built area are basically consistent.
